MySQL是一种关系型数据库管理系统,用于存储和管理数据。用户管理是MySQL中的一个重要部分,允许管理员创建、修改和删除用户账户,以控制对数据库的访问权限。
MySQL中的用户类型主要包括:
用户管理在以下场景中尤为重要:
如果你在MySQL中新建了一个用户但无法登录,可能是由以下几个原因导致的:
以下是一些可能的解决方法:
my.cnf
或my.ini
),确保没有阻止用户登录的设置。特别注意bind-address
和skip-networking
等配置项。以下是一个完整的示例,展示如何创建一个新用户并授予权限:
-- 创建新用户
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
-- 授予所有权限
G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ost';
-- 刷新权限
FLUSH PRIVILEGES;
通过以上步骤,你应该能够解决新建用户无法登录的问题。如果问题仍然存在,请提供更多的错误信息以便进一步诊断。
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
企业创新在线学堂
企业创新在线学堂
企业创新在线学堂
腾讯云数据库TDSQL训练营
“中小企业”在线学堂
云+社区技术沙龙[第17期]
腾讯云数据库TDSQL(PostgreSQL版)训练营
领取专属 10元无门槛券
手把手带您无忧上云